Travel Score in 22151, Springfield, Virginia

The Travel Score for the COPD Score in 22151, Springfield, Virginia is 77 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

49.40 percent of residents in 22151 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 5.70 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Inova Fairfax Hospital with a distance of 3.70 miles from the area.

**Driving the Healthcare Landscape**

For many, the automobile remains the primary mode of transportation. Springfield's road network, while extensive, can present challenges. Major arteries like the **Capital Beltway (I-495)**, the **Franconia-Springfield Parkway (VA-795)**, and **Interstate 95 (I-95)** are crucial for navigating the region. However, these highways are notoriously congested, especially during peak hours.

The drive time to the nearest hospitals, such as **Inova Fairfax Hospital** in Falls Church, can vary significantly. During off-peak hours, the journey via the Beltway might take approximately 20-30 minutes. However, during rush hour, this commute can easily stretch to 45 minutes or even an hour, impacting the time-sensitive needs of COPD patients. Similarly, reaching **Sentara Northern Virginia Medical Center** in Woodbridge, though further south, involves navigating I-95, which presents its own set of potential delays.

Local roads like **Backlick Road**, **Rolling Road**, and **Old Keene Mill Road** provide alternative routes, but they often involve traffic lights and slower speeds. Careful route planning is essential, and real-time traffic information is a must-have tool for any driver. For individuals with COPD, who may experience fatigue or shortness of breath, the stress and physical demands of driving in heavy traffic can exacerbate their symptoms.

**Public Transit: A Mixed Bag**

The Washington MetroMetropolitan Area TransitWashington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ority (WMATA), or **Metro**, offers a public transit alternative. The **Franconia-Springfield Metro Station**, located within the 22151 ZIP code, provides access to the **Blue Line**. This line offers direct service to various healthcare facilities, including those in downtown Washington, D.C.

However, the Metro system has its limitations. While most stations are equipped with elevators and escalators, ensuring ADA accessibility, navigating the system can still be challenging for individuals with mobility issues or breathing difficulties. Transfers, especially during peak hours, can be crowded and require significant walking. Furthermore, the frequency of trains, particularly during off-peak hours and weekends, might necessitate longer wait times, potentially adding to the stress of travel.

The **Fairfax Connector** bus system also serves the Springfield area. Several bus routes connect to the Franconia-Springfield Metro Station and provide access to local destinations, including medical offices and clinics. However, bus travel can be time-consuming, and the availability of wheelchair-accessible buses may vary depending on the route and time of day.

**Ride-Sharing and Medical Transportation: Filling the Gaps**

Ride-sharing services like **Uber** and **Lyft** offer another layer of transportation options. These services provide on-demand transportation, offering a potentially convenient alternative to driving or public transit. However, the cost of ride-sharing can be a significant factor, especially for frequent medical appointments. Furthermore, availability can be unpredictable, particularly during peak hours or in areas with limited driver coverage.

Medical transportation services, such as **CareRide** and **Medicaid transportation providers**, cater specifically to the needs of individuals with medical conditions. These services often provide door-to-door transportation, including assistance with boarding and disembarking, making them a valuable option for COPD patients. However, these services may require advance booking and may have limited availability, particularly for urgent appointments.
